Dimensional Fund Advisors LP Purchases 11,093 Shares of Elevance Health, Inc. (NYSE:ELV)

→ Who are Nvidia’s Silent Partners? (From Weiss Ratings) (Ad)

Dimensional Fund Advisors LP boosted its position in shares of Elevance Health, Inc. (NYSE:ELV - Free Report) by 0.6%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 1,860,723 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 11,093 shares during the quarter. Dimensional Fund Advisors LP owned about 0.79% of Elevance Health worth $877,412,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Elevance Health Company Profile

(Free Report)

Elevance Health,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a health benefits company in the United States. The company operates through four segments: Health Benefits, CarelonRx, Carelon Services, and Corporate & Other. It offers a variety of health plans and services to program members; health products; an array of fee-based administrative managed care services; and specialty and other insurance products and services, such as stop loss, dental, vision, life, disability, and supplemental health insurance benefits.
